I have a hard time using SmugMug forums for some reason. So I'm hoping someone on here can help me. I like smugmug but some things I just find it really hard to adjust (So maybe I'm an idiot).

I want to reorganize the galleries here:

//tatedavidson.com/Photography/Portrait-Sessions

Anyone know an easy way to do it on SmugMug?

When you're logged in to your account, you should see "Sort Galleries: Arrange" just above your galleries. At least that's what I see just above the "Mostly Mammals" gallery on this page from my site when I'm logged in.

If you just want to put them in alphabetical order then I would suggest Stiger's idea but if you want to place them differently on the page then you're going to have to change the CSS. If you need help doing either I can help you.

Actually, on my arrange page, there are arrows that I can use to move individual galleries to any position in the lineup that I want. There is also a "quick sort" for arranging by title, date, etc.

Thanks - that was accurate. I had the galleries set up to auto arrange by date so I needed to change that. Then it let me move stuff manually.

I had some other issues so I ended up contacting smugmug help. Turns out my CSS code I had was messed up so that was causing some other "opportunities" for improvement.
